Advanced Corrosion Protection Riptide motors are impervious to saltwater's corrosive effects, thanks to premium-grade marine alloys and aluminum upper arms. Metals undergo a rigid multi-step cleaning process before being anodized or coated with a special zinc dichromate armor plating. All components are then finished with a durable 5-mil TGIC polyester, powder coat paint. When it's all done, you're left with unequaled corrosion protection.
Full Encapsulated Electronics Marine-grade urethane fully encapsulates Riptide control boards to protect the electronic circuitry. Also, all electrical connections are sealed with liquid-tight heat shrink tubing to form an impregnable barrier against saltwater
Sacrificial Anode Galvanic corrosion occurs when two dissimilar metals come into electrical contact through saltwater. Riptide fights back with a sacrificial zinc anode, a composite shaft and properly balanced materials that are close in electrical potential. The result is a motor that's completely protected from saltwater's destructive forces.
